This set of four dining chairs from 1960s Germany represents a mid-century brutalist approach, crafted from solid wood. The construction features chunky, slightly splayed legs and a rectangular seat, all finished in a semi-matte, warm honey-brown tone that highlights the expressive wood grain. Each chair’s backrest is defined by a distinctive heart-shaped cut-out, referencing folk or alpine motifs. The joinery remains visible and direct, with no upholstery or metal fittings, emphasizing craftsmanship and honesty of material. These chairs are not equipped with adjustable features, focusing instead on sturdy, lasting construction. The surfaces display minor authentic signs of use—light scratches, patina, and natural coloration—typical for their age. The set remains in very good condition, free from major damage or repairs.
